Air pollution comes from a wide variety of sources.In Bangladesh poisonous exhaust from industrial plants, bricks kilns, old or poorly-serviced vehicles and dust from roads and construction     sites are some of the major sources of air pollution
We can minimise this type of pollution by making less use of motor vehicles avoiding the use of vehicles older than 20 years.We may also use proper lubricants to lessen the level of emission and pollutants.We can encourage people to use Compressed Natural Gas (CNG) or Liquid Petroleum Gas(LPG) for fuelling their cars.The government may relocate hazardous industries like brick kilns to areas away from human habitation

Since the beginning of recorded history, humans have attempted to mask or enhance their own odor by using perfume , which emulates nature's pleasant smells. Many natural and man-made materials have been used to make perfume to apply to the skin and clothing, to put in cleaners and cosmetics, or to scent the air. Because of differences in body chemistry, temperature, and body odors, no perfume will smell exactly the same on any two people.



Perfume comes from the Latin "per" meaning "through" and "fumum," or "smoke." Many ancient perfumes were made by extracting natural oils from plants through pressing and steaming. The oil was then burned to scent the air. Today, most perfume is used to scent bar soaps. Some products are even perfumed with industrial odorants to mask unpleasant smells or to appear "unscented."


While fragrant liquids used for the body are often considered perfume, true perfumes are defined as extracts or essences and contain a percentage of oil distilled in alcohol. Water is also used. The United States is the world's largest perfume market with annual sales totaling several billions of dollars.

Hair is a part of our personal style. Hair fashion is considered to be a sphere of personal grooming and attitude. Hairstyles are done generally as practically but popular and cultural considerations influence hairstyles.

Fashion of women’s hairstyles rose since ancient civilization. At that time, women’s hair was elaborately dressed in many special ways. Women let their hair grow as long as they naturally could from the time of Roman Ages to the Middle Ages. In the 16th century women wore their hair in ornate ways in western world. There have been many invention of wide variety of styles by their culture. In some cultures, women’s hair was covered with coverings in public. European women’s hair became more visible than ever it was from the 16th century. In England, red hair was popularized by red haired queen Elizabeth.

Atie is a long piece of cloth worn for decorative purposes around the neck or shoulders, resting under the shirt collar and knotted at the throat. It is a great part of formal outfit for men all over the world. Wearing a tie matching with style, attitude and attire is greatly appreciated. Besides, Tie is also used as uniform along with as formal outfit.

 As tie has been playing a significant role in completing formal dress many cloth companies are producing variety of ties together with development of fashion.Hermes,this French classic house of fashion is renowned for their quality silks and subtle designs which are instantly recognizable.Duchamp London is Specialists in traditional suits, shirts and trousers with a modern edge, Duchamp make very fine ties in bold colors for men who wish to stand out from the crowd, yet still maintain a “British” look.Charvet of France is another popular company for tie. Other well-known tie manufacturing companies are Carlo Franco, Kiton and Burberry etc.


There are different kinds of tie popular among men. Variants include the ascot tie, bow tie, bolo tie, zipper tie, cravat and clip-on tie, four in hand, skinny tie, pre-tied ties etc.

Clothing is fiber and textile material worn on the body. The wearing of clothing is a feature of nearly all human societies. The amount and type of clothing worn is dependent on physical stature, gender, as well as social and geographic considerations. Once it was an only basic need but now it has a significant fashionable value.

In the fashionable world men and women are advancing simultaneously. It is better to wear dresses matching with situation in today’s world. There are many clothing companies producing clothes for male which are of great fashion with brand value. Some companies are Lenixton, Topman, Benetton, hagger etc.



In general, men wear shirts and pants all over the world. But there are some differences of clothing based of class and ages of people. There are also kinds of fashion such as formal, casual. Suit is a popular formal dress in almost all over the world.

Casual dress refers to the popular clothing among the mass people of all classes and ages irrespectively. Kids normally wear T shirts. Shirts, jeans, jacket and shoes are very much popular with boys. People wear coat, tie, suit in meeting and program.

People of our Indian subcontinent wear Lungi and Dhoti as traditional dress. In perspective of religious view a dress code exists among people. Muslims wear Panjabi with Pajama when they perform religious ceremonies. Men also wear sporting wears like tracksuit, leotards, T-shirts while sporting.

Clothing refers to any coverings for the human body. The wearing of clothing is exclusively a human characteristic and is a feature of most human societies. Clothing performs as a form of adornment and an expression of personal taste on style. Women have their distinguished types of clothing based on religious and social perspective. Here is a brief discussion about types of women’s clothing.

Clothing of women is different in many parts of the world. In Indian-subcontinent women generally wear their traditional dress. Saree is one of the most known dresses. Besides, salwarkameez, ghagracholi and churidarare also popular in this region. Among the muslim in this region the burqua is common for them. Also in other parts of Asia, women have their traditional clothing. With the progress of modern world some modern fashions of clothing among women have been made so far in this part of the world. In western countries, women wear western dresses such as shirts, jeans, skirt and other kind of their traditional dresses.




Women of the 21st century dress mostly for comfort, returning to earlier styles. The new millennium doesn't focus on any one style, but offers individuality as there isn't a certain fashion that dictates what women should follow. Hoop earrings, which had been popular in the 1980s and early 1990s, returned in popularity. Gel bracelets became the rage in 2004. Women of the first decade of the 21st century are considered more fashionable going casual rather having a formal look, with the exception of going to church, business functions and special events.
